What Is Slot Volatility?
Volatility, also known as variance, refers to how often a slot machine pays out and how large those payouts tend to be. Think of it as the risk level associated with a particular game. Understanding volatility helps players choose slots that match their playing style and bankroll.
Low vs. High Volatility Slots
Low volatility slots deliver frequent smaller wins, making them ideal for players who prefer steady gameplay and extended sessions without big swings. These games keep your balance relatively stable.
High volatility slots feature less frequent payouts, but when they hit, the rewards are substantially larger. These games suit risk-tolerant players with adequate bankrolls who enjoy the thrill of chasing big jackpots.
